FLOATING RATE LIBOR BONDS (Seventh Series)
·      
Issued on the 1st, 8th, 15th and 22nd of each month.
·      
Initial interest rate is equal to the 6-month LIBOR rate in effect on the initial interest determination date plus or minus a spread. The spread remains fixed until maturity.
·      
Interest paid every June 1st and December 1st.
·      
3-Year, 3-Year Financing, 4-Year and 10-Year Floating Rate LIBOR Bonds (Seventh Series) are not offered in this sales period.
